gibson042 commentedJun 20, 2017
80f1c82 worked everywhere except IE9: http://swarm.jquery.org/result/2255930
Investigation traced the root cause to a mishandling by that browser of
box-sizing: content-box, particularly in combination withoverflow: scroll... specifically,getComputedStyleseems to always report content box dimensions, even for border-box elements, and the lack of accounting for scrollbars means that round-trip set operations shrink such elements: https://jsbin.com/zotomuqoho/edit?html,css,js,output
